Transaction 37a28733f93892e62e14076c7bb9a3b0cf6680246d3e2a7d8d698b1342941e6e

4 Input
2 Outputs
  • 37a28733f93892e62e14076c7bb9a3b0cf6680246d3e2a7d8d698b1342941e6e:0
  • value  390356
    address  16qEmwvDtxNtYtS4usiJAtqFzuVrcu6HDz
  • 37a28733f93892e62e14076c7bb9a3b0cf6680246d3e2a7d8d698b1342941e6e:1
  • value  10600000
    address  34NG5mQZdRVLfGa9VnBUXakreK1fPUZSmG